An installer is allways gona be required . Blame microsoft for it , but there is no other way to setup the C++ runtime libs. http://emudev.com/drkIIRazi/vc2k5_sp1_x86.rar If you install that , the plain files should work. About joystick support , just use joy2key for now. |

So far, I'm impressed... now let me add another game to that list: Sonic Shuffle Computer specs: AMD Sempron 2600+ (soon to be replaced) 1024 MB DDR Ram GeForce 6600 GT Windows XP nullDC configuration: Several tested: -CP pass disabled -Dynarec disabled -Chankast graphics plug-in Status with original (Echelon) ISO: Only until main menu That's actually better than all other DC emulators so far, those even crashed before the main menu. In nullDC no matter what options are selected in the main menu once you leave it the screen goes black, the music accelerates to normal speed and over! Additionally the menu initialization shows a minor graphics glitch! Intro works! I have added a (probably useless) screenshot of the console output after it crashes Add: Status with hex-edited ISO: Works Open the ISO in a hex-editor: search for the following hex string: 20 90 0E A0 09 00 01 7E Change the first instance of the finding to: 20 90 09 00 09 00 01 7E as you see, only 2 bytes are changed.. but those 2 bytes make the ISO compatible (seems like nearly 100%) - there will be errors in the console but ignore them, it will work! note: this edit was done on the MDF file.. if you have CDI version I am not sure whether this works but I guess so! note 2: this edit makes the rom incompatible to Chankast (will show an error and abort) - demul will run it but still won't reach the menu Status In debugger: Works Stop the game when it seems to have crashed.. step through every instruction until you reach a "bra" command.. skip that command! The command is the following: 8C029802 bra 0x8C029822 ; I guess it would be safe to overwrite that command with a "nop" command, just I haven't seen a function for doing so! This command and an additional "rts" command puts the game in an endless loop Bugs: major graphical issues in split-screen minigames! Last edited by Link0x; April 2nd, 2007 at 18:58.. Maken-X (NTSC-U) Computer specs: Athlon XP 2800+ (2.1 GHz) GeForce 6600 nullDC configuration: Default nullDC configuration Status: Playable NB - Maken X is one quirky FPS that plays rather well. nullDC has transparency and clipping issues, and the FPS dips below 40 when multiple opponents are on-screen simultaneously. During the intro the audio became garbled and the voices muted. Considering how Chankast ran this game I'm quite impressed, but there remain tons of bug fixing to be done. Well done! ![]() ![]()
